前言:想要寫出一篇引人入勝的文章?我們特意為您整理了液壓支架電液控制系統(tǒng)設(shè)計分析范文,希望能給你帶來靈感和參考,敬請閱讀。
摘要:針對現(xiàn)有液壓支架電液控制系統(tǒng)存在穩(wěn)定性差、適應(yīng)性弱以及延時較長的問題,基于C8051F020芯片設(shè)計液壓支架電液控制系統(tǒng),給出電液控制系統(tǒng)總體設(shè)計框圖,并基于該框圖詳細分析硬件、軟件系統(tǒng)設(shè)計。經(jīng)實驗測試,基于傳感器技術(shù)、RS485通信以及SPI通信技術(shù),該系統(tǒng)能夠?qū)崟r、準(zhǔn)確地傳送液壓控制器間數(shù)據(jù),保障了液壓支架動作的準(zhǔn)確性。
關(guān)鍵詞:C8051F020芯;軟件;測試
引言
液壓支架是煤礦井下綜采工作面的重要設(shè)備之一,分布于整個綜采工作面,主要完成采空區(qū)的支護工作,即在采煤機后方,液壓支架完成降柱、抬底、移架、落底、升柱、伸護幫以及推溜動作,對采空區(qū)進行支護,同時將刮板輸送機向工作面方向推進一個步距;在采煤機前方,液壓支架完成收護幫動作,為采煤機截割煤壁留出空間[1]。為提升綜采工作面生產(chǎn)效率,研究液壓支架電液控制系統(tǒng)使得液壓支架能夠根據(jù)采煤機實時位置,自動完成各種動作,同時配合采煤機、刮板輸送機完成采煤任務(wù)。液壓支架電液控制系統(tǒng)是集機械、液壓以及電氣為一體的復(fù)雜控制系統(tǒng),英國道梯公司最早提出并研究液壓支架電液控制系統(tǒng),并形成以控制先導(dǎo)閥為目標(biāo)的控制體系,并將按鈕式微控制液壓系統(tǒng)應(yīng)用于美國的坎賽爾煤礦;德國研制的Panematic2E、Paner2-matic2S5、PM2、PM3以及PM4等支架電液控制系統(tǒng)在煤礦井下得到廣泛應(yīng)用;日本三井三池、波蘭EMA以及法國、美國等也先后研制出可靠、功能較完善的液壓支架電液控制系統(tǒng)[2-5]。國內(nèi)的北京煤機廠、鄭州煤機廠、煤科總院太原分院等也相繼研制出液壓支架電液控制系統(tǒng),并在大同礦務(wù)局、邢臺煤礦以及神東煤礦得到廣泛的應(yīng)用[6]。為進一步增強液壓支架電液控制系統(tǒng)的穩(wěn)定性、可靠性以及適應(yīng)性,基于單片機控制技術(shù),完成液壓支架電液控制系統(tǒng)的設(shè)計。
1系統(tǒng)設(shè)計
煤礦井下液壓支架電液控制系統(tǒng)主要完成操作支架的所有動作,如升/降立柱、推溜、移架、拉架等。操作者通過支架控制器的按鍵發(fā)出控制命令,可實現(xiàn)對液壓支架的單架控制、臨架控制、成組控制、就地閉鎖、緊急停止等。液壓支架控制器通過獲取傳感器組實時數(shù)據(jù),并經(jīng)A/D轉(zhuǎn)換后,結(jié)合液壓支架控制器存儲參數(shù),作為控制液壓支架的條件。操作者通過液壓支架控制系統(tǒng),可完成對液壓支架控制過程的功能設(shè)置和參數(shù)設(shè)置,設(shè)置的參數(shù)信息多樣且可調(diào),使液壓支架控制系統(tǒng)具有較強的靈活性和適應(yīng)性。操作者通過液壓支架控制系統(tǒng)可查看液壓支架狀態(tài)信息,如控制(工作)狀態(tài)、故障錯誤信息、設(shè)置及參數(shù)值、檢側(cè)值以及控制器本身的某些運行參數(shù)等。液壓支架控制器有LED字符顯示窗口,各種LED狀態(tài)顯示及蜂鳴器作為信息媒體,使系統(tǒng)與操作者之間得到良好的溝通。液壓支架電液控制系統(tǒng)設(shè)計總體框圖見圖1所示,根據(jù)綜采工作面的長度,配置支架控制器個數(shù)。支架控制器獲取傳感器組數(shù)據(jù)并經(jīng)邏輯處理后,控制器電液換向閥進行控制液壓支架執(zhí)行相應(yīng)的動作。支架控制器之間以RS485進行通信,并經(jīng)耦合器后與井下主機、井下交換機相連,最終以TCP/IP通信模式將數(shù)據(jù)發(fā)送至地面主控計算機。
2硬件設(shè)計
液壓支架電液控制系統(tǒng)中支架控制器主芯片選用C8051F020高性能處理芯片,一個機器周期只由一個時鐘周期組成,可執(zhí)行一條指令;該芯片允許擴展中斷源,可擴展至22個;片內(nèi)資源包括8~12位多通道ADC,8~64個通用I/O口,2個UART以及Flash、RAM、片內(nèi)時鐘、看門狗等,滿足支架控制器設(shè)計要求。電液控制系統(tǒng)中所用的關(guān)鍵傳感器主要技術(shù)參數(shù)如表1所示。液壓支架電液控制系統(tǒng)的電源為雙路DC12V電源,由AC85V-AC265V電源經(jīng)A/C開關(guān)電源模塊以及過壓、過流保護電路處理后,輸出DC12V電源,保證電液控制系統(tǒng)的正常供電。雙向隔離耦合器主要用于對支架控制器之間的RS85以及SPI通信信號進行電氣隔離和信號耦合,保證電液控制系統(tǒng)通信質(zhì)量。
3軟件設(shè)計
液壓支架電液控制系統(tǒng)的軟件采用C+匯編語言編程實現(xiàn),在KeilC51軟件中完成控制系統(tǒng)的軟件程序編寫,在proteus軟件平臺搭建硬件實現(xiàn)電路并進行仿真。圖2所示為液壓支架控制系統(tǒng)軟件主流程,在完成系統(tǒng)初始化以及資源配置后,執(zhí)行鍵盤掃描程序,巡檢是否有按鍵按下。如果有按鍵按下,則執(zhí)行按鍵功能子程序;如果沒有按鍵按下,則檢查中斷信號,是否需要執(zhí)行中斷子程序。液壓支架電液控制系統(tǒng)的中斷子程序包括模式切換、單架控制、臨架控制、成組控制、集中控制以及遠程控制中斷子程序。圖3所示為液壓支架電液控制系統(tǒng)的模擬量信號采集軟件流程,為完成液壓支架動作,支架控制器需要實時采集壓力、位移、紅外以及傾角傳感器的模擬量信號,經(jīng)A/D轉(zhuǎn)換以及軟件濾波后,進行邏輯處理,控制電液換向閥動作。
4系統(tǒng)測試
在實驗室完成液壓支架電液控制系統(tǒng)的調(diào)試與測試,測試內(nèi)容主要包括單架單動作控制、鄰架單動作控制、鄰架聯(lián)動控制、成組自動控制、急停/閉鎖控制以及聲光報警控制等。利用液壓支架控制人機界面對液壓支架進行操作,經(jīng)對測試數(shù)據(jù)進行記錄、統(tǒng)計和分析,該電液控制系統(tǒng)能夠較好地完成液壓支架控制。
5結(jié)語
針對綜采工作面液壓支架分布數(shù)量較多,電液控制系統(tǒng)的實時性、穩(wěn)定性較差的問題,設(shè)計并開發(fā)基于C8051F020芯片的液壓支架電液控制系統(tǒng),在軟件實現(xiàn)中設(shè)計多種控制模式,滿足液壓支架的控制要求,同時基于RS485以SPI完成支架控制器之間的數(shù)據(jù)通信。系統(tǒng)測試結(jié)果表明,所設(shè)計的電液控制系統(tǒng)能夠滿足綜采工作面液壓支架控制要求,保證煤礦安全、穩(wěn)定生產(chǎn)。
參考文獻
[1]申寶宏,郭玉輝.我國綜合機械化采煤技術(shù)裝備發(fā)展現(xiàn)狀與趨勢[J].煤炭科學(xué)技術(shù),2012,40(2):1-3.
[2]馬鵬宇,余佳鑫,陸廷鍇,等.國產(chǎn)液壓支架電液控制系統(tǒng)現(xiàn)狀[J].中國機械,2013(11):211-212.
[3]伍小杰,于月森,等.液壓支架電液控技術(shù)的現(xiàn)狀及展望[J].煤炭科學(xué)技術(shù),2009,37(1):25-29.
[4]楊世華,宋建成,田幕琴,等.基于雙RS485總線的液壓支架運行狀態(tài)監(jiān)測系統(tǒng)開發(fā)[J].工礦自動化,2014,40(8):1-5.
[5]蔣春悅,田慕琴,宋建成,等.自動化工作面液壓支架控制器設(shè)計[J].工礦自動化,2014(9):1-5.
[6]郭衛(wèi),李績.PLC在礦用液壓支架電液控制系統(tǒng)中的應(yīng)用研究[J].煤礦機械,2015,36(1):3-5.
作者:王瑞彪 單位:西山煤電(集團)有限責(zé)任公司機電修造園區(qū)科技發(fā)展分公司